B.Tech I Year II Semester (R15) Supplementary Examinations November 2017
ENGINEERING DRAWING
(Common to ME and IT)

Time: 3 hours Max. Marks: 70

--- Content provided by FirstRanker.com ---


(Answer all five units, 05 X 14 = 70 Marks)
*****

UNIT ? I

--- Content provided by​ FirstRanker.com ---


1 A parallelogram has sides 130 mm and 80 mm at an included angle of 60
0
. Inscribe an ellipse in the
parallelogram. Find the major and minor axes of the ellipse.

--- Content provided by‍ FirstRanker.com ---

OR
2 A circle of 50 mm diameter rolls along a line. A point in the circumference of the circle is in contact with
the line in the beginning and after one complete revolution. Draw the cycloidal path of the point. Draw
an tangent and normal at any point on the curve.

--- Content provided by‍ FirstRanker.com ---

UNIT ? II

3 Construct a diagonal scale of R.F. 1:20 showing divisions of 0.01 m and capable of measuring 3 meter.
Mark a distance of 2.37 m on it.
OR

--- Content provided by⁠ FirstRanker.com ---

4 A point is 30mm in front of VP, 20 mm above HP and 25 mm in front of the left PP. Draw its projections.

UNIT ? III

5 A line AB 60 mm long has one of its extremities 20 mm in front of VP and 15 mm above HP. The line is

--- Content provided by‍ FirstRanker.com ---

inclined at 25
0
to HP and 40
0
to VP. Draw its top and front views.

--- Content provided by‍ FirstRanker.com ---

OR
6 A hexagonal lamina of 30 mm sides on HP on one of its sides. The side which is on HP is perpendicular
to the VP and the surface of the lamina is inclined to the HP at 45
0
. The lamina is then rotated through

--- Content provided by‌ FirstRanker.com ---

90
0
such that the side on HP is parallel to the VP, while the surface is still inclined to the HP at 45
0
.

--- Content provided by FirstRanker.com ---

Draw the front view and top view of the lamina in its final position.

UNIT ? IV

7 An equilateral triangular prism 20 mm side of base and 50 mm long rests with one of its shorter edges

--- Content provided by⁠ FirstRanker.com ---

on HP such that the rectangular face containing the edge on which the prism rests is inclined at 30
0
to
HP. The edge on which the prism rests is inclined at 60
0

--- Content provided by‌ FirstRanker.com ---

to the VP. Draw its projections.
OR
8 A square prism of base side 30 mm and axis length 60 mm is resting on HP on its base with a side of
base inclined at 30
0

--- Content provided by‌ FirstRanker.com ---

to VP. It is cut by a plane inclined at 40
0
to HP and perpendicular to VP and is
bisecting the axis. Draw the development of the remaining part of the prism.

--- Content provided by‌ FirstRanker.com ---
